The Cluny Reform refers to a significant movement within the Catholic Church during the 10th and 11th centuries. It originated from the Benedictine monastery of Cluny, located in present-day France. The reform aimed to address the perceived corruption, laxity, and abuses within the Church and to restore a stricter adherence to monastic ideals.

At the time, many monastic communities had deviated from the original rules set forth by Saint Benedict of Nursia, who established the Benedictine Order in the 6th century. Monasteries had become wealthy and powerful, often involved in secular affairs, and some monks were leading lives contrary to their spiritual calling.

The Cluny Reform sought to renew the commitment to monastic discipline, devotion to prayer, and celibacy among the clergy. It emphasized the importance of liturgical worship, the proper observance of the Rule of Saint Benedict, and the autonomy of monastic communities from secular interference. The reform also advocated for the elimination of simony (the buying and selling of church offices) and the end of lay investiture (the practice of secular rulers appointing church officials).

Under the leadership of influential abbots, such as Odo of Cluny and his successor, Saint Hugh, the Cluny Reform gained widespread support and attracted numerous monasteries across Europe to join the movement. These Cluniac monasteries adhered to a stricter interpretation of the Benedictine Rule, practised a more solemn liturgy, and placed a strong emphasis on personal piety and moral conduct.

The Cluny Reform played a significant role in revitalizing monastic life, promoting religious devotion, and combating corruption within the Church. It had a lasting impact on the medieval Church and contributed to the broader Gregorian Reform movement, which sought to reform various aspects of the ecclesiastical structure, including the papacy and the relationship between the Church and secular powers.

During the last Ice Age, large portions of Earth's water were trapped in glaciers, causing global sea levels to drop. This resulted in the emergence of a land bridge between Asia and North America, known as Beringia. This land bridge allowed human migration across the continents.

However, as the Earth's climate gradually warmed, the glaciers melted, causing the sea levels to rise. This rise in sea levels eventually submerged the land bridge, cutting off the connection between Asia and North America. The process of submergence occurred over thousands of years, and the rising waters permanently eliminated the land bridge.

what innovative feature of gothic cathedrals is an external support that counters the outward thrust of the nave vaults?

Answers

The innovative feature of Gothic cathedrals that counters the outward thrust of the nave vaults is called a flying buttress.

Gothic cathedrals are known for their grandeur and architectural advancements. One of the key innovations in Gothic architecture is the flying buttress. The flying buttress is an external support system that plays a crucial role in countering the outward thrust of the nave vaults. It consists of an arched structure that extends from the upper portion of the outer wall and connects to a solid pier or support column. This system effectively transfers the weight and lateral forces of the vaults to the ground, preventing the collapse of the structure.
The flying buttress was a groundbreaking solution that allowed architects to create taller and more spacious interiors by reducing the need for thick, solid walls to support the vaults. By utilizing this external support system, Gothic cathedrals were able to achieve lofty heights and expansive, light-filled spaces.

The introduction of flying buttresses marked a significant milestone in architectural engineering and remains one of the defining features of Gothic architecture.

The political dynamics of the state of Texas changed dramatically after the 1994 election. The political transformation of the state occurred in 1994. Texas Democrats lost their hold on the state, as Republicans won the governorship and took control of both houses of the Texas Legislature for the first time since the end of Reconstruction in 1873. Since then, Texas Democrats have been relegated to minority status in the state. The Republican Party has had a firm grip on Texas politics, winning all major statewide races and dominating the state Legislature for decades. In the 2018 elections, Texas Democrats made significant gains, but they still remained a minority party in the state. The best description of the term "the Holocaust" is "the systematic killing of Jews by Nazis."

The Holocaust refers to the genocide that took place during World War II, specifically targeting Jews as well as other groups such as Roma, disabled individuals, political dissidents, and LGBTQ+ individuals. The Nazi regime, led by Adolf Hitler, implemented a state-sponsored campaign of persecution and extermination, aiming to eliminate European Jewry and establish an Aryan supremacy. This campaign involved various methods, including mass shootings, forced labor, and most notably, the establishment of extermination camps where millions of individuals were systematically murdered, primarily through the use of gas chambers. The Holocaust resulted in the deaths of approximately six million Jews, making it one of the most horrific atrocities in human history.

All of the following exporting costs are included in "Price FAS" Except Plant Overhead Option 2 Product Modification Legal and Negotiating Expenses Export Terminal Charges Loading Vessel Charges Resea Dr. Stacey Moran works with organizations to improve their safety practices for both clients/customers and employees. Dr. Moran received her Ph.D. in I/O psychology from Pennsylvania State University in 1991. She is a member of the Workers Compensation and Cost Containment Department for St. Paul Travelers Insurance Company. Her role is to help organizations apply principles of psychology to issues involving health and safety at work. As the oldest insurance organization in the United States, St. Paul Travelers is very interested in helping their customers reduce the number and severity of accidents and injuries they suffer. Dr. Moran helps them accomplish this by providing consulting to insureds and company representatives, putting on training programs about safety, and conducting surveys about accident experiences and safety practices. She deals with all areas of OHP (Occupational Health Psychology), including accidents, burnout, stress, and violence. One of her projects was a survey of organizations in the outdoor adventure industry in North America. This is a rapidly growing service industry that provides outdoor recreation with activities such as camping, rock climbing, and white-water rafting. Many these organizations are in the nonprofit sector, such as Boy Scouts and Girl Scouts. The industry is quite concerned about safety, as many of the activities people engage in have the potential for injury. The goal of this project was to collect information from a large sample of organizations about their safety concerns and practices. This would provide a picture of the state of the industry that could inform where efforts should be targeted to improve safety. Dr. Moran worked in collaboration with Outward Bound, USA, a St. Paul Travelers' insured and the oldest and largest outdoor adventure program in the world. She helped design a survey that was sent to 1,265 organizations throughout North America, and 294 useable surveys were returned (nearly 25% ). She analyzed the results and wrote a report for the industry. The results showed that members of the adventure industry are concerned about safety but that the areas of concern don't necessarily match where their safety efforts are placed. For example, the two major issues identified were driver safety and instructor judgment training. Page 1 of 4 However, most respondents reported that their organizations failed to provide training in these areas. The major conclusions were that improvements are needed in three areas: training, assessment of risk and tracking of accident/injury patterns, and development of safety cultures where injury prevention is a major objective. Interestingly there was a high correlation between customer/client injuries and employee injuries-those organizations that had a high incidence of one had a high incidence of the other. Thus it would be expected that practices that reduced injuries for one group would reduce injuries for the other. Dr. Moran's report was widely distributed throughout the industry to inform organizations about the steps they should take to increase safety. This project illustrates how positive change in organizations can be accomplished by providing specific information about effective actions that can be taken to solve an important problem.
